Concerns raised over HSE overspend of 'several hundred million' by year-end

Fianna Fáil has raised concerns that the HSE will have overspent by “several hundred million” by year-end after the health minister revealed that it had run up a revenue deficit of more than €116m by the end of April.
During leaders’ questions yesterday, Simon Harris said the HSE’s position as of April 30 showed a deficit of €116.2m, up from €103m for the first three months of the year.
